A5:SQL Mk-2

開発のこと、日々のこと

インデックスの列定義で降順(desc)にした場合、DDLの生成でdescの定義が不正

ホーム フォーラム A5:SQL Mk-2掲示板 インデックスの列定義で降順(desc)にした場合、DDLの生成でdescの定義が不正

4件の投稿を表示中 - 1 - 4件目 (全4件中)
  • 投稿者
    投稿
  • #2855 返信
    gx
    ゲスト

    不具合と思われますので、ご報告いたします。

    Ver: 2.13.2 32bit
    RDBMS種類: Microsoft SQL Server 2008~

    インデックスとユニーク制約 の 列定義: score desc
    出力されるDDL:
    create index hoge_IX1
    on hoge(score,desc);

    以下のような出力を期待しています。
    on hoge(score desc);

    ” desc” が “,desc” で出力されています。
    ご確認よろしくお願いいたします。

    #2897 返信
    松原正和
    キーマスター

    gx さんこんにちは。

    不具合報告ありがとうございます。

    Version 2.14.0 beta 5で修正しました。また、Version 2.13系の修正にも取り込みたいと思います。

    #2905 返信
    gx
    ゲスト

    ご対応ありがとうございます。
    Version 2.14.0 beta 5で修正されていることを確認いたしました。

    続けて申し訳ありませんが、主キーに”desc”を指定したい場合、ERエディタ上で設定可能でしょうか?
    操作方法のご教示もしくはご対応いただけますと幸いです。

    (主キーにdescを付ける出力例)
    create table NEW_ENTITY1 (
    CreatedAt
    , constraint NEW_ENTITY1_PKC primary key (CreatedAt desc)
    ) ;

    #2955 返信
    松原正和
    キーマスター

    gxさんこんにちは。
     
    明示的に主キー項目に desc を付けるオプションはないので、主キー項目と同じ列にユニークインデックスを作り、そこでdesc等を指定しておくしかないですね…。
     
    あまりよろしくないのでちょっと考えてみたいと思います。

4件の投稿を表示中 - 1 - 4件目 (全4件中)
返信先: インデックスの列定義で降順(desc)にした場合、DDLの生成でdescの定義が不正で#2905に返信
あなたの情報:




コメントは受け付けていません。